Attitude of a Developing Country Towards Sports Tourism

Journal Title: Psychology and Education: A Multidisciplinary Journal - Year 2022, Vol 1, Issue 2

Abstract

This study adopted a descriptive survey in identifying the attitude of respondents towards sports tourism. The study was conducted in the Philippines where the said country was considered as a developing country. Respondents were active participants and audiences of a certain sports event conducted in the country. The researcher used frequency and distribution in analyzing the demographic profile of the respondents and weighted mean in interpreting the attitude of the respondents towards sports tourism based on the three domains, namely; economic, socio-cultural, and environment. T-test was also utilized in testing the significant difference of the attitudes of the respondents when grouped according to their classification as sports tourists. Based on the result of the study the respondents show a positive attitude towards the impact of sports tourism in the economic and environmental dimension of sports tourism while a neutral attitude towards socio-cultural. Hence, sports tourism as a flourishing type of tourism in the country is appreciated by the local people.
